    The design and development of a learning strategy to enhance students' engagement in simultaneous equations: an evaluation viewpoint

    Get PDF
    In the 21st century, teaching and learning mathematics courses witness significant expansion and development of technology use, which creates a shift from teacher-centred to student-centred learning engagement. Student engagement (SE) faces many challenges of poor performance and student difficulty in solving simultaneous equations involving indices (SEII), among others. This paper presents an evaluation viewpoint of the learning strategy (LS) with cooperative learning strategy (CLS) and GeoGebra (GG) integration to support SE in SEII. The LS employs the think-pair-share approach and the six (6) principles of learning phases associated with constructivism ideology. The discussion of the preliminary mathematical achievement test (MAT-test) from pre-and post-tests with 41 students who have learned SEII using the developed LS is also presented. Semi-structured interviews were conducted with three experienced lecturers to provide feedback and recommendations on interacting with LS. The themes that emerge from those lecturers include the connection between LS phases, specific material, cooperative activity, playfulness in the discovery process, and thinking. Experts’ feedback on the LS’s content reasoning and content learning strategy through a questionnaire was tested using Fleiss multi-rater Kappa and showed good inter-rater reliability and agreement between them. The estimated marginal means covariate of the ANCOVA test was then examined, and the results supported the necessity for a learning strategy to be developed. The findings revealed that the LS, with CLS and GG integration, has the potential to be educationally effective in enhancing SE in SEIIPeer Reviewe

    Identification of Cooperative Learning Component in Designing Lesson Plan for Building Drawing Subject in Vocational Colleges

    Get PDF
    Cooperative learning is a student-centered learning technique that can be considered a learning strategy for improving student performance both intellectually and in soft skill acquisition.  Changes in curriculum structure in vocational institutions, because of the TVET transformation in 2012, have had an unforeseen influence on teaching and learning, whereas in the prior framework, a detailed teaching guideline was supplied compared to the latest structure.  Teachers with inadequate knowledge and experience in learning strategies struggled to execute the new curriculum structure due to the lack of depth in these recent curriculum structure. This may be seen in the case of construction drawing subjects, where there were originally 14 main topics but now there are just four. Thus, the goal of this research is to help these teachers by offering a guideline for creating lesson plans that use a cooperative learning strategy.  The aim of this paper is to identify and highlight the important component in the creation of a lesson plan using cooperative learning.  For this investigation, the fuzzy Delphi technique was used.  The main instrument for this study is a questionnaire survey that was developed utilizing a construct identified through literature and the results of a previous needs analysis.  A total of 15 expert panels were chosen as the sample, which included university lecturers, vocational college instructors, officers from the Ministry of Education's Technical and Vocational Training Division, and industry representatives. The data was analyzed with the help of Microsoft Excel FDM.  Visual skills, Cooperative Student Team Achievement Division (STAD), Power Point, and demonstrations components have been recognized as the major component to include in the lesson plan based on the analysis. With these components identified, a good lesson plan guideline for the next phase of this study can be constructed.  It is envisaged that the development of such guidelines would help to elevate the practice of teaching and learning to the next level

    Challenges and experience in training intellectually disabled students in the national floristry competition: toward the worldskills competitions

    Get PDF
    Malaysia is one of the 85 member nations competing in the WorldSkills Competition, which unites two-thirds of the world’s population. The WorldSkills mission is to encourage and assist 100 million young people in advancing their skills by 2030. This study investigated how teacher (special education teacher), the community (instructor), and expert, train an intellectually disabled student for the National Floristry Competition. As a precursor for the WorldSkills Competition, this study examined their experiences and difficulties in training intellectually disabled student for this competition. This study uses a purposive sampling method with three participants rather than a random one. Based on a case study research design, it employs ethnographic participant observation and in-depth interviews, among other techniques. The study determined that student with special needs should participate in international skill competitions as early as possible. The Malaysian floristry industry has significant untapped potential, and students with intellectual disabilities can access it if they receive ongoing guidance and training. To be successful in the WorldSkills Competition, Malaysia must overcome financial, time, and knowledge limitations. This study illustrates the difficulties and lessons learned in preparing an intellectually disabled student for the national floristry competition. These empirical investigations result in a deeper understanding and are crucial to academicians as the path for future planning and generating future young talents for the WorldSkills Competition

    Digital Pedagogy Policy in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) in Malaysia: Fuzzy Delphi Approach

    Get PDF
    Digital platforms are one of the technology adoption that is beginning to be used in most vocational colleges today. Services provided through digital platforms are an alternative to conventional methods. However, the use of digital platforms nowadays, among users consisting of vocational college students in Malaysia is still at a less than satisfactory level. Previous studies also focused a lot on the use and acceptance of technology platforms among users in schools only but not in vocational colleges (VC). The aim of the research is to determine the experts’ consensus on the objective of the digital pedagogy policy for Technical Education and Vocational Training (TVET) students especially in vocational colleges which is currently under development. Vocational colleges is one of the Technical Education and Vocational Training (TVET) institutions in Malaysia that offers certificate level and skill diploma education to high school students. Therefore, it is important to identify the policy that will be used. The Fuzzy Delphi Technique (FDT) was used in this research. Ten experts were chosen by utilizing the purposive sampling method. Analysis of the data was using the Triangular Fuzzy Number and Defuzzification process. The findings showed 100% consensus was achieved by the experts for objectives 1 and 3, and 90% consensus was achieved by the experts for objective 2. All of the experts agreed on the elements in the objectives of the digital pedagogy policy for TVET students. Further development of this policy hopefully will help the teachers in improving their knowledge of digital pedagogy and increase their competency pedagogy in order to produce skills oriented workforce among TVET students in Malaysia. Therefore, the results of this study are expected to be used to strengthen the development of e-learning models in the future to help students and educators to use digital platforms in vocational colleges in particular

    Socio-economic impact of riverbank failure at Kg. Pohon Celagi in Pasir Mas, Kelantan, Malaysia

    Get PDF
    Riverbank failure is a geological phenomenon that occurs when the soil or rock comprising the bank of a river collapses, leading to the rapid erosion of land and the formation of large cracks and sinkholes. While it is a natural occurrence, riverbank failure can have severe consequences for nearby communities and the environment. A massive riverbank failure occurred along the Kelantan River in Kampung Pohon Celagi, Pasir Mas, Kelantan, Malaysia. In this study, the affected area of the riverbank failure was determined and the effects of the bank failure on the village socio-economics and community were investigated. This study utilized interview methods and field observations to collect data and information. The study shows that 0.58 km3 land in the village was affected by the riverbank failure. The local authorities designated the 50-m range from the riverside as the red zone where most houses and buildings collapsed with the riverbank movement, and the parameters were 51–100 m is the high-risk area, 101–150 m is moderate, and ≥ 151 m upwards is low risk area, respectively, from the riverbank. The affected communities were required to move to safer areas and leave their properties to be demolished or failure with the riverbank. Socioeconomically, businesses around the disaster area were affected as they were prohibited from operating in the high-risk area. Overall, the disaster resulted in the local communities losing their property and experiencing depression. As a result, it is expected that all stakeholders will work together to develop a solution that ensures the well-being and safety of the community from riverbank failure

    Picture-vocab: Self-made picture dictionary to improve pupils’ vocabulary retention in Malaysia

    Get PDF
    This project was conducted to investigate whether the use of pictures able to improve pupils’ vocabulary retention. There were 36 pupils from an urban school located in Malaysia who are in year 4 involved as participants. The pupils were of average proficiency level of the English Language. A pre-test and post-test were conducted in order to identify the effectiveness of the intervention. An interview was carried out with 10 pupils in the post intervention for triangulation purpose. The scores from the pre-test and post-test were compared to measure the effectiveness of the intervention. Whereas, the analysis of the interview was procured on pupils’ perception towards the intervention. The findings indicate that pupils are able to remember the vocabularies taught for a longer period of time when the words are associated with pictures. Findings also indicate the use of the pictures in improving their vocabulary retention

    Pendekatan Mengurus Konflik dalam Rumah Tangga Bermadu: Approach in Managing Conflict in A Polygamous Household

    Get PDF
    Conflict is an unavoidable condition and is part and parcel of life in a household, especially in the lives of a polygamous household. This article aims to present the factors that contribute to household conflict and the approach in managing them. The data were obtained through semi-structured interviews with sampling techniques aimed at 5 sister-wives and 1 polygamous husband. The interview data transcriptions were analyzed to form themes and sub-themes and validation was performed using Cohen Kappa calculations. The data analysis revealed that the internal factors which trigger conflict are secretive marriage, lack of concern, jealousy, and misunderstanding, whereas the external factors are neglecting responsibility, difficulty in adjusting, and lack of communication. Among the approaches taken to manage this conflict are to hold discussions, to be generous, to be tolerant, to care for each other, to appreciate, to be patient, to accept the qada' and qadar of Allah Almighty, to protect the household’s honour, and to limit unimportant social activities. This finding can serve as a guide in the management of polygamous household conflicts.
